Innovative Solutions to Ghana's Textile Waste Crisis

This chapter discusses how the community in Cantamanto, Ghana, is creatively addressing the textile waste crisis through upcycling discarded garments into new products. It highlights the empowerment of local workers and the community's efforts to promote sustainability and environmental benefits.
